Portugal - Hospital Discharges for Malignant Neoplasm of Bladder
Since 2013, Portugal Hospital Discharges for Malignant Neoplasm of Bladder increased 0.3% year on year. At 5,129 Hospital Discharges in 2018, the country was number 18 comparing other countries in Hospital Discharges for Malignant Neoplasm of Bladder. Portugal is overtaken by Belgium, which was ranked number 17 with 6,386 Hospital Discharges and is followed by Sweden at 4,474 Hospital Discharges. Germany, Italy and France resp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. Chile recorded the best 5 years average growth at +6.2% per year, while Denmark witnessed the worst performance at -8.8% per year.
